To use a custom image that haven’t build yet, use build element


services:
  foo:
    build:
	    content: <folder/that/hold/dockerfile>  
	    dockerfile: Dockerfile   #name of the dockerfile
		arg: # we can also supply the runtime arg for the build
			some_arg: some_value 

If service used a name volume, volume must be defined (anonymous volume and bind mount is not needed)

services:
	foo:
		image: busybox
		volume: 
			- /app/data   # anonymous volume
			- data:/data/db   # named volume
			- /folder:/app   # bind mount

volumes:
	- data

common command

# -d = in detached mode (run on the background without terminal)
docker-compose up -d
# stop all container, -v also remove the volume we defined
docker-compose down -v
# build the missing image in the custom build, without starting a container
docker compose build
# rebuild docker compose
docker compose up -d --no-deps --build <service_name>
